DuPont Mobility and Materials Kalrez® 4079 FFKM Perfluoroelastomer
Categories: Polymer; Thermoset; Fluoropolymer, TS; Thermoset Fluoroelastomer; Rubber or Thermoset Elastomer (TSE)

Material Notes: A low compression set compound for general-purpose use in O-rings, diaphragms, seals, and other parts used in the process and aircraft industries. It is a carbon black-filled compound with excellent chemical resistance, good mechanical properties, and outstanding hot air aging properties. It exhibits low swell in organic and inorganic acids and aldehydes and has good response to temperature cycling effects. Max recommended operating temperature is 316°C, with short excursion to higher temperatures possible. This compound is not recommended for use in hot water/steam applications or in contact with certain hot aliphatic amines, ethylene oxide, or propylene oxide.

Physical PropertiesMetricEnglishComments
Density 2.02 g/cc0.0730 lb/in³ISO 1183
 
Mechanical PropertiesMetricEnglishComments
Hardness, Shore A 7575ASTM D 2240
Elongation at Break 150 %150 %ASTM D 412
100% Modulus 7.20 MPa1040 psiASTM D 412

Thermal PropertiesMetricEnglishComments
CTE, linear 361 µm/m-°C201 µin/in-°FISO 11359-1/-2
Maximum Service Temperature, Air 316 °C601 °FDuPont proprietary test
Minimum Service Temperature, Air -19.0 °C-2.20 °FDuPont proprietary test
 -2.00 °C28.4 °FRetraction temperature TR-10; ASTM D 1329
 
Descriptive Properties
ColorBlack
Polymer(FFKM)
